## Break-Glass: Fieldfare CSV Import Wizard

Welcome aboard! Quick heads-up for contractors: the Fieldfare import wizard occasionally wedges itself during huge batch uploads, and the admin console locks the staging queue as a precaution. Normal fix is to ping whoever's on rotation, but if it's after hours and a client demo is at risk, you're allowed to break glass. Open the wizard's maintenance panel, choose "Emergency Unlock," and enter the recovery passphrase shown below.

unlock words, hahip-yagef: zorok-novmir-zorix-silax

Subject: Key rotation — Partivault monthly partitioner

Team,

We rotated the key for the Partivault service that partitions the orders table by month. Old key dies Friday. The nightly partition job and the support dashboard both use it; update any local scripts before then. No schema changes — partitions still roll over on the 1st. Questions go to the data platform channel. New key is below.

gateway credential: kto7_2Gnwrkn

## Sandboxing user formulas — Tallgrain

All user-supplied formulas run inside the Fennel interpreter with no filesystem, network, or clock access. CPU budget: 50ms per evaluation; memory cap: 16MB. Violations kill the worker and log to the quarantine stream.

Before release: confirm the sandbox allowlist matches the shipped grammar, run the escape-test suite twice, and verify the kill-switch flag toggles cleanly in staging. Record results against the candidate build, whose token appears below.

pipeline stamp: htk9_ce63042d9

## Deploying the Gatewick Proctor Queue

Deploys are pretty painless: push to main, wait for the pipeline, then watch the queue drain dashboard for five minutes. If candidates pile up mid-exam, roll back first and ask questions later — the queue replays safely. Everything the workers care about lives in one config block, shown here for reference.

settings of bafof-yagef:
JOROX_PIN=8740
JOROX_TENANT=pelox
JOROX_METRICS_HOST=metrics.jorox.qorvelworks.internal
JOROX_SEAL=seal_c78f63c1
JOROX_STANDBY_TEAM=norax